NDC Primaries: OSP Is Looking Into The NDC MP Candidate Who Sprayed Money

The National Democratic Congress (NDC) held presidential and parliamentary elections on Saturday, May 13, in Ejura Sekyedumase, in the Ashanti Region. On that day, money was seen being thrown at a crowd, and the Office of the Special Prosecutor (OSP) has announced that it is looking into Madam Juliana Kinang-Wassan, one of the candidates for parliament from the Ejura Sekyedumase Constituency, who was spotted engaging in such acts.

She was deemed necessary for inquiry, the OSP claimed.

“You are directed to attend the Office of the Special Prosecutor at 6 Haile Selassie Avenue, South Ridge, Accra on Thursday, May 18, 2023, at 10 am for interviewing. You may be accompanied by counsel of your choice,” a letter from the OSP said.

The police added that they were evaluating the candidate’s behavior. “A dedicated legal team is currently scrutinising her conduct in the video to establish whether there are elements of election-related crime to warrant Police intervention or otherwise,” the Police said in a statement.

A move by the Office of the Special Prosecutor (OSP) to invite NDC MP candidate Juliana Wassan for allegedly throwing money during Saturday’s primaries at Ejura, according to Captain Kwame Jabari (rtd), First Vice Chairman of the National Democratic Congress (NDC) in the Ashanti Region, is “crazy.”

“What is the OSP’s locus in this matter; is the OSP crazy?” Jabari fumed in an interview on Monday, May 15. He alleged, “The Office of the Special Prosecutor has been selective in the execution of its mandate.”

Asiedu Nketia Declares The NDC Party Is Now Ready To Win The 2024 General Elections

The National Democratic Congress (NDC) claims that the results of its primaries for president and parliament on Saturday, demonstrate unequivocally that the party is capable of winning the 2024 election.

Johnson Asiedu Nketiah, the NDC’s National Chairman, claims that the caliber of those elected demonstrates the party’s will for success.

The NDC has chosen John Mahama as its presidential candidate for the elections of 2024, as well as legislative candidates to represent it in the various constituencies. Over the weekend, the party organized primaries around the country.

Johnson Asiedu Nketiah declared that the NDC is prepared for battle, during the announcement of the presidential results.

“We are happy that so far, the quality of candidates that have been produced in this election gives us confidence that we will go into 2024 and win the presidential and win a considerable majority in Parliament and also deliver on the charge of rescuing this country. We are not going to say we have the men. We want the men to prove themselves for you to say that yes, the NDC has the men.”

Johnson Asiedu Nketiah

17 incumbent Members of Parliament were denied the opportunity to run in the elections of 2024. However, John Dramani Mahama secured the victory with 98.9% of the vote.

“I am humbled by the overwhelming confidence reposed in me by the party. I want to thank God for bringing the NDC this victory. Traversing the country for all these days, weeks, and months without fatalities can only be by God’s special favour.

“My profound gratitude goes to the delegates of our party for their warm welcome, active engagement, and participation during my tour. In your usual astute manner, you turned up in your numbers across the country to vote in our party’s presidential and parliamentary primaries.”
